Solution Overview
Problem
Conventional noise shaping type successive approximation analog-digital converters experience increased latency during digital conversion processes, which can deteriorate the responsiveness of feedback control systems.
Innovation Solution
The proposed AD converter includes an input part, an AD conversion part, and two output parts, where the AD conversion part generates both high-resolution first digital data and low-latency second digital data, with the second digital data being output before the first digital data, allowing for improved feedback control responsiveness.
Engineering Contradictions & Design Principles
Engineering Contradiction Analysis
1Measurement precision
If a digital filter of a ΔΣ type AD converter is performed to increase the resolution of output data, then the resolution is improved, but the latency increases and responsiveness of feedback control is deteriorated
Solution Approach 1:
The patent segments the digital conversion process into two parallel paths: a first path that performs full digital filtering for high-resolution output data, and a second path that provides low-latency feedback data with reduced filtering. This segmentation allows the system to obtain both high-resolution control data and low-latency feedback signals simultaneously, resolving the contradiction between resolution improvement and latency reduction.
2Measurement precision
If an integration circuit is added to achieve noise shaping characteristic, then the resolution is improved, but the device complexity increases
Solution Approach 1:
The patent uses a copying approach where the second digital data (low-latency feedback signal) is generated as a simplified copy of the full conversion process, omitting the integration and digital filtering stages. This allows the system to maintain noise shaping characteristics through the first path while the second path provides a faster, simpler alternative for feedback control, reducing overall device complexity while maintaining resolution benefits.

Provided are an analog-to-digital (AD) converter, a sensor processing circuit, and a sensor system capable of improving responsiveness of feedback control. AD converter includes input part, AD conversion part, first output part, and second output part. The analog signal output from sensor is input to input part. AD conversion part digitally converts an analog signal to generate first digital data and second digital data. First output part outputs the first digital data to control circuit. Second output part outputs the second digital data to sensor before first output part outputs the first digital data.
